ABOUT VILLAGEREACH

VillageReach transforms health care delivery to reach everyone, so that each person has the health care needed to thrive. We develop solutions that improve equity and access to primary health care**.** This includes making sure products are available when and where they are needed and primary health care services are delivered to the most under-reached. Radical collaboration with governments, the private sector and other partners strengthen our ability to scale and sustain these solutions. Our work increases access to quality health care for more than 58 million people in Africa. VillageReach in incorporated in Washington State and has offices in Seattle (USA), Democratic Republic of Congo, Malawi, and Mozambique.

DESCRIPTION

Summary

This position is vital to the success of private sector engagement at VillageReach and is a key member of the PSE team. The position holder will support VillageReach programs and solutions in developing a PSE strategy and plan and will oversee the contributions of a broad range of private sector firms (logistics, telecommunications, pharma distribution etc.). The individual will ensure that needed contracts and service level agreements are in place and will participate in joint performance reviews with program teams and private sector partners to ensure a healthy partnership and to support achievement of program objectives.

Description

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ties, responsibilities, and activities may change or be assigned at any time.

Demand/Supply Matching (20%)

  • Yearly/Bi-Yearly – Lead development and update of a PSE Strategy & Plan for each program and solution with the Objectives, Scope, Stage, Partner/Potential Partners, Targeted Outcomes and Needed Start Date. Includes Key Principles and Risk Assessment (risks and mitigation actions)
  • Yearly/Bi-Yearly – Lead assessment of progress versus the PSE Strategy & Plan; identify corrective actions for each solution and program

Solution Definition (20%)

  • On-going: Support private firms in developing strategies, business plans and operational plans needed to enable their effective involvement in VillageReach programs
  • On-going: For private sector TA partners (PLM, ARC, etc.), lead scoping of specific interventions, with clear project charters, and ensure that interventions are properly staffed both by TA partner and VillageReach
  • On-going: Support program and solution team in implementation of activities in partnering agreement, including Business Plan definition, solution costing, private sector workplan, and team definition

Solution Delivery (60%)

  • On-going: Lead development of Service Level Agreements (SLAs) between govts. and private firms
  • On-going: Lead implementation of Joint Performance Reviews to drive on going collaboration between private sector firms and govt.
  • On-going: Ensure involvement of private sector firms in VillageReach’s work on solution costing
  • On-going: Support identification of private firm needs for technical and managerial capacity building and define capacity building plan
  • On-going: Lead technical and managerial capacity development of private sector firms, including growing their capacity to work with public sector partners
